Never? Not even after a crash? Does your install ever crash on startup?
That's when I see problems with lost clusters, truncated files and
FAT misreporting. It just happened again today. SCANDISK identified
the following files as damaged: Arachne.pck, History.lst, Cache.idx,
Pppdrc.cfg, and Ppp.log

There were also 31 lost clusters. SCANDISK fixed all this for me and
now Arachne is working just fine. This crash and recovery is routine
for me.

I rarely see any problem with the editor. But SCANDISK has never shown
any file errors when I have had rare editor problems, just after
Arachne startup crashes. (total crash and system reboots itself)
